The deferred deletion functionality stores the event loop level
nesting count in the QEvent d pointer. In Qt 4, this d pointer was
not usable because we forgot to add a proper copy constructor and
assignment operator to it, so the deleteLater() process stored the
count here safely.
Since Qt 5 now has non-implicit copy methods, the d pointer could be
used in the future. If QEvent uses it, this assertion will
trigger. Note that it doesn't apply to classes derived from QEvent,
though.

Reimplementations of connectNotify() and disconnectNotify() can
assume that the signal argument is in normalized form, but after the
introduction of the Qt5 meta-object format, it could happen that it's
not.
The problem is that the internal QArgumentType class, which attempts
to resolve a typename to a type id, was calling QMetaType::type().
QMetaType::type() falls back to trying the normalized form of the
typename if the original argument can't be resolved as a type (this
behavior isn't documented, but that's how it works). This means that
e.g. QMetaType::type("const QString &") returns QMetaType::QString.
Since QMetaObjectPrivate::indexOfMethodRelative() (more specifically,
the methodMatch() helper function) prefers to compare type ids
over typenames (since the type ids are stored directly in the meta-
object data for built-in types), the method lookup would *succeed*
for signatures with non-normalized built-in typenames as parameters.
QObject::connect() would then think that it did not have to
normalize the signature (see "// check for normalized signatures").
The consequence was that the original, non-normalized form got
passed to connectNotify().
This commit introduces an internal typename-to-type function that
is the same as QMetaType::type(), except it doesn't try to normalize
the name. This way, the only place where normalization can occur in
the signature-to-meta-method processing is through the calls to
QMetaObject::normalizedSignature() in QObject::connect() itself.
The implication is that there are now cases where the method
signature will be decoded and processed twice, where processing it
once was sufficient before. On the other hand, it is consistent with
the pre-Qt5-meta-object behavior, where we predict that the
signature is already normalized, and only perform (comparatively
costly) normalization if the initial lookup fails.

This API will fully replace the const char *-based connectNotify()
and disconnectNotify() in Qt5; the old functions will be REMOVED
before Qt 5.0 final.
The new implementation fixes the long-standing issue of
connectNotify() not being called when using the (internal)
index-based QMetaObject::connect() (e.g., from QML).
As with the old API, there are still two "unintuitive" behaviors
concerning disconnectNotify():
- disconnectNotify() is not called when the signal is disconnected
using the QObject::disconnect(QMetaObject::Connection) overload.
- disconnectNotify() is not called when a receiver is destroyed
(i.e., when a connection is implicitly removed).
The old versions of connectNotify() and disconnectNotify() are kept
for now, and they are still called. They will be removed once known
existing reimplementations (e.g., QtNetwork, QtDBus) have been
ported to the new API.

Given a member function that's a signal, returns the corresponding
QMetaMethod. Inspired by the implementation of the template-based
QObject::connect().
The primary use case for this function is to have an effective and
exact (not subject to shadowing) way of checking whether a known
signal was connected to in reimplementations of
QObject::connectNotify(QMetaMethod), avoiding string comparisons.
Example:
void MyObject::connectNotify(const QMetaMethod &signal)
{
if (signal == QMetaMethod::fromSignal(&MyObject::mySignal)) {
// Someone connected to mySignal ...
}
}

QMetaObjectExtraData was added when support for QMetaObject::newInstance
was added. One needed a place to put the pointer to static_metacall in
the QMetaObject.
But as we break binary compatibility, one can change the size of
QMetaObject, and put everything back inside QMetaObject's own structure.
Meaning it is not required anymore to have one QMetaObjectExtraData
instance per QMetaObject anymore.
